Goldn Futures Mineral Corp GFTRF


Primary Symbol: C.FUTR

Gold'n Futures Mineral Corp. is a Canada-based exploration company. The Company is focused on acquiring, advancing and developing high-potential Canadian precious metal properties. The Company's projects include Hercules Gold, Brady Gold and Handcamp. The Hercules Gold Project is a 10,052 hectares (ha) property, which is located approximately 210 kilometers (km) northeast of Thunder Bay, Ontario in the townships of Elmhirst and Rickaby, within the municipality of Greenstone in the Thunder Bay North Mining District. The property lies within an Archean greenstone belt. The Brady Gold Project is located approximately 50 km south of the town of Grand Falls, Windsor in central Newfoundland and is approximately four km west of the Newfound Gold Corp., Queensway South gold project. The Handcamp Property is located in central Newfoundland, over 13 km south of the town of South Brook and approximately one km east of the Trans-Canada Highway.

Old Drill Results include......

Old Drill Results include......

The veins pinch and swell non-systematically horizontally and vertically. The Wilkinson Lake-Yellow Brick Road vein system has a combined strike length of 3 km. In the 2006 drilling program, two drillholes with significant results were observed in the Wilkinson Lake Gold Zone ("WLGZ"). These drillholes were HR06-02 grading 9.22 g Au/t over 13 m from 11.3 m to 30.3 m, and HR06-03 grading 19.64 g Au/t over 13.15 m from 26.4 m to 39.55 m. Other significant drill intersections include 38.47 g Au/t over a down-hole width of 1.6 m at Marino (HR07-16), 12.85 g Au/t over 1.1 m including 0.3 m grading 53.24 g Au/t at 7 of 9 (HR08-113) and 15.59 g Au/t over a true width of 9.7 m (including 51.65 g Au/t over 2.83 m) at Wilkinson Lake (HR07-03). Drillhole HR08-145 was successful in extending the high grade WLGZ down plunge, where it intersected 3.3 m grading 22.26 g Au/t, including 90 g Au/t over 0.8 m (Kociumas and Power-Fardy, 2010). Visible gold is seen on surface in the Marino vein and at depth in drill core from the 7 of 9 vein (Assessment report 20000006750).
